my shift lever is stuck in park
my 1994 f150 is stuck in park after about 5 min of working the ignition switch back and forth it shifted in gear but when I put in back in park and shut the ignition off it does it again its something to do with the ignition switch. I know when the key is not in it and turned on the steering wheel and shifter wont move which is normal. when I got the key on the steering wheel will turn but the shifter wont move. any ideas ?

Most likely the wire(s) on the brake light switch on the brake pedal are making intermittent contact.
Repair those wires and you should be good to go.

Same thing happened on old escape. Tried to leave store and wouldnt leave park. Tried rocking the truck tried a bunch of things till google said if brake lights dont work its a fuse.
Fuse blows - brake lights stop working - park wont disengage because it doesnt see brakes on.
Terrible design.
